What is Student VA Form

The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ities is a student consent form used by students receiving veterans' educational benefits to acknowledge their responsibilities regarding enrollment and VA policies.

What is the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ities?

The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ities is a crucial document for students accessing veterans' educational benefits under Title 38. This form defines the essential responsibilities students have while enrolled in VA-supported programs. It serves a vital role in ensuring compliance with VA policies, including the acknowledgment of responsibilities related to enrollment and any changes that may occur.
Understanding Title 38 is important as it outlines the eligibility criteria for veterans seeking educational benefits. By completing this form, students confirm their commitment to adhering to these guidelines. The acknowledgment of responsibilities is a key aspect of the educational process, fostering a transparent relationship between the VA and the students.

Purpose and Benefits of the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ities

The primary purpose of the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ities is to clarify student responsibilities regarding the maintenance of their enrollment status. It outlines the necessity for students to promptly notify the VA of any changes that may impact their benefits. Understanding the contents of this form helps students align with VA policies, ensuring smooth processing of their educational benefits.
  • Promotes awareness of student responsibilities while enrolled.
  • Aids in the timely submission of required forms to avoid disruptions in benefits.
  • Reduces the likelihood of issues arising during benefits processing.

Who Needs the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ities?

This form is essential for students who are eligible to receive educational benefits under Title 38. Any student who seeks to access these benefits needs to complete the Statement of Student Understanding and Responsibilities. Various scenarios highlight the necessity of the form, including initial enrollment and changes in academic status.
Students who fail to submit this form may face significant consequences, including delays in accessing their educational benefits. Ensuring that this requirement is met is fundamental to maintaining eligibility for financial support.

This form is intended for students enrolled in educational programs funded by veterans' educational benefits under Title 38. It is crucial for any student receiving these benefits to understand their responsibilities.
Typically, the form should be submitted before the start of each academic term to ensure that veterans' benefits can be processed without delay. Always check with your institution for specific deadlines.
The form can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ller directly to your institution, or you may download it and send it via email or post depending on your institution's requirements.
In most cases, students must provide their VA eligibility letter, along with any identification documents required by their educational institution. Verify your school's specific requirements.
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ately, particularly your personal information and signature. Double-check that you have understood and acknowledged all responsibilities listed.
Processing times can vary by institution but typically take one to two weeks. Check with your school for precise processing times regarding veterans' benefits forms.
If changes are necessary after submission, contact your educational institution’s admissions or veterans' affairs office as soon as possible to inquire about their policy for amendments.
